Background of the $1,702 Stimulus Payment

The $1,702 payment in 2025 is provided through Alaska’s Permanent Fund Dividend programme, a long-standing initiative that began in 1976.

The fund was created to save a portion of the state’s oil revenues for future generations and provide residents with an annual financial dividend. Over the decades, the PFD has become a critical source of income for many Alaskans, supplementing wages and social benefits.

The amount varies yearly depending on the performance of the fund’s investments and economic considerations. In 2025, the $1,702 includes not only the standard dividend based on fund earnings but also an energy relief bonus of approximately $298.17.

This bonus was introduced to help households manage the rising costs of fuel and utilities, reflecting Alaska’s focus on adjusting social support according to economic realities.

Who Qualifies for the $1,702 Stimulus Payment in September 2025?

Eligibility for this payment is specifically defined by the Alaska Department of Revenue and includes several key requirements:

  • Residency: Applicants must have been residents of Alaska for the entire calendar year 2024.
  • Intent to Remain: They must intend to remain Alaska residents indefinitely.
  • No Other Residence Claims: Applicants cannot have declared residency in any other state or country during 2024.
  • Physical Presence: A minimum presence of 72 consecutive hours in Alaska at any time during 2023 or 2024 is required.
  • Absence Limit: Total absences should not exceed 180 days in the qualifying year, with some exceptions.
  • Criminal Record: Applicants must not have been convicted of a felony or imprisoned during the eligibility year.
  • Application Submission: Eligible residents must submit their applications on or before September 3, 2025, to qualify for the September distribution.

Over 600,000 Alaskans are expected to receive the 2025 payment, reflecting the broad reach and importance of this programme within the state community.

How Is the $1,702 Stimulus Payment Calculated?

The payment combines multiple elements:

  • Base Dividend: Derived from the Permanent Fund’s investment earnings in the previous year, primarily 2024.
  • Energy Relief Bonus: A supplementary payment of around $298.17 added to help residents cope with the rising energy costs impacting daily life.

Combined, these components form the $1,702 payment amount for 2025. The state’s careful balancing of fund performance and public economic needs ensures continued sustainability of this valuable programme.
